Frequently Asked Questions

What is the rental yield in SW6?

SW6 has a gross rental yield of 2.7%. The median property price is £857,925 with typical monthly rents of £1,950, based on Land Registry and VOA data.

Is SW6 a good area for buy-to-let?

SW6 yields 2.7%, below the England average of 3.6%. The area may offer stronger capital growth. Compare with other postcodes in Hammersmith and Fulham for alternatives.

What is the median property price in SW6?

The median property price in SW6 is £857,925, based on 3,128 Land Registry transactions over 3 years. This compares to £730,000 across Hammersmith and Fulham as a whole.
